Mobile Phlebotomist/Paramedical Examiner

On-siteGig Harbor, Washington, United States

Part TimeEnterprise

Job Summary

Conduct mobile medical collections at applicants' homes, workplaces, or specified locations by performing venipuncture, manual blood pressure checks, vitals assessment, and urine specimen collection. Manage your personal calendar of availability to select specific days and hours for on-call shifts. Verify minimum 100 successful practical blood draws and hold an MA-P or Washington State health license prior to on-boarding. Maintain reliable transportation, current auto insurance, and own necessary equipment including a computer, internet, cell phone, printer, and scanner. This role supports ExamOne's paramedical exam services for life, health, and disability insurance underwriters.
